J R Goraj, MD - Bethesda Christian Counseling, located in Sioux Falls, SD, and Orange City, IA, offers a therapeutic approach that emphasizes both healing and growth in individuals facing various emotional and relational challenges. Their therapists aim to guide clients towards new and effective patterns of thinking, feeling, and relating, recognizing the potential for personal redemption and health through the therapeutic process.

Believing that therapy should ultimately foster independence, Bethesda strives to work efficiently towards clients' goals, with an average treatment duration of six months. The practice prioritizes building a strong therapist-client relationship while ensuring clients acquire life skills necessary for maintaining their mental, spiritual, and relational well-being beyond therapy.

Southeastern Behavioral Health Center

Southeastern's Counseling and Children's Services provides the emotional support and guidance necessary to help individuals effectively cope with their lives, from childhood through adulthood. Counseling and Children's Services provides assistance for children and their families as they work through life's challenges. With guidance from counseling staff, families can find hope. Services provided include individual, family, and group therapy. Outpatient counseling services are provided to individuals of all ages for a wide range of problems such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, ADHD, and parent/child problems. Services include: individual therapy, group therapy, family therapy, marital therapy, parent/child counseling, psychiatric evaluation and services, and psychological services. Home, school, and community based counseling. Homebased Services is an intensive, non-residential treatment program providing services to eligible children and their families. The program incorporates counseling, case management and family support services. These services are designed to assist in the development of a nurturing and stable family environment in which children may grow. A homebased counselor along with family, individuals supporting the family and professionals will develop a customized treatment plan which will assist in meeting the needs of the child and family.
